Question

Ce qui est effectué dans les coulisses quand un programme fonctionne avec nohup?

est le PID du processus parent étant changé?

Merci.

modifier : I entendu que nohup (et disown) provoque que SIGHUP ne soit pas envoyé au processus si le processus parent reçoit. Est-ce que cela veut dire qu'il est équivalent à la manipulation SIGHUP (et ne pas tenir compte réellement)?

Était-ce utile?

La solution

Utilisez la source, Luc!

(caractères supplémentaires pour maintenir la nouvelle longueur réponse des règles heureux.)

Autres conseils

Il est équivalent au réglage du gestionnaire d'SIGHUP à SIG_IGN, ie.

signal(SIGHUP, SIG_IGN);

Le article sur Wikipédia nohup explique assez bien.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top